There are a lot of BSc courses that doesn't require Mathematics.Some of them are given below :
BSc in Botany,Zoology, Agriculture,Forensic Science, Physiotherapy, Nursing, Environmental Science, Occupational Therapy, Anthropology, Pathology, Microbiology, Speech Therapy, Genetics, Audiology, medical Laboratory Technology.

Hello Amit !
The syllabus of LEET is Engineering Mechanics, Basic Electrical Engineering, Basic Electronics Engineering, Engineering Graphics, Elements of computer science, elementary Biology, Basic Workshop Practice and Physics/Chemistry/Maths of Diploma standard.

I assume you are asking about tseamcet, by clearing tseamcet exams you may go for below courses,
bachelor in technology in various discipline
bachelor of pharmacy
doctor of pharmacy
B.Sc. (Hons.) Agriculture
B.Sc. (Hons.) Horticulture
B.Sc. (Forestry)
B.V.Sc. & Animal Husbandry
B.F.Sc. – Bachelor of Fisheries Sciences
